TURN-208: Gatevale turnstile counters at the Merrow Field pilot double-count when a rotation reverses mid-cycle. Attendance totals drift roughly 2% high per event. The debounce window fix is implemented, reviewed by Ilsa, and soak-tested across two simulated match days without drift. Ready for your cut; the candidate build is identified below.

trace token, tagag-tafog: htk6_5ed18c

## Formula sandbox tuning

User-supplied formulas in Gridmoor execute inside a restricted interpreter with hard ceilings on time, memory, and call depth. Reviewers should confirm any change to these ceilings is justified in the PR description, since raising them widens the abuse surface. Defaults were chosen from production traces. The current limits are as follows.

limits module of tafog-fawip:
WEIGHTS = {
    "julix": 57,
    "lamys": 992,
    "kasvan": 209,
    "quenok": 750,
    "alddor": 259,
    "oliath": 1009,
    "wenix": 815,
}

Subject: Handover — RecordMerge dedup service. Hi team, passing release ownership of RecordMerge to Ilsa starting Monday. The customer-record deduplication jobs run nightly; support should route merge complaints to the new queue. Deploys require the signed bundle, same as before. For continuity, the active deploy key is included directly below.

rollout seal: bky19_s9HJCAxw7cq1UWv6zx9

## Step 4: Swap the renderer

Replace the legacy Inkhorn markdown pass with the new Fennel pipeline. Delete the old sanitizer hook; Fennel sanitizes post-render. Reviewer note: check that footnote anchors still resolve — this broke twice during the Bramblewood pilot. No schema changes. Feature flag stays off until QA signs. The pipeline reads the following settings at startup.

deployment values, yadug-bawif:
[framir]
team = pelox
access_code = ac_a38ab2
owner = tamion.julael
host = framir.tolvaqlabs.test
port = 11211
peer = tammir.zemvargrid.local
salt = 2215ef03
pin = 1541

Handover — Rhys to new starters. Goods lift at Dunmarle Wharf is deliveries only before noon. Prop nothing in the doors; it jams the interlock. Couriers wait at the cage, you bring goods through. Sign the intake sheet every run. The cage gate takes the pass code below.

staff pass of kawep-hahap = bdg-IEUUF-6